ASIAN DEVELOPMENT BANK (SPECIAL FUNDS CONTRIBUTIONS) AMENDMENT ACT 1976
No. 147 of 1976
An Act to amend the Asian Development Bank (Special Funds Contributions) Act 1970.
BE IT ENACTED by the Queen, and the Senate and House of Representatives of the Commonwealth of Australia, as follows:—
Short title.
1. This Act may be cited as the Asian Development Bank (Special Funds Contributions) Amendment Act 1976.
Commencement.
2. This Act shall come into operation on the day on which it receives the Royal Assent.
3. After section 5 of the Asian Development Bank (Special Funds Contributions) Act 1970 the following section is inserted:—
Transfer to Asian Development Fund.
“5a. (1) Notwithstanding anything in sections 4 and 5, the Minister may, on behalf of the Commonwealth, make an agreement with the Bank providing for—
(a) the transfer to the Asian Development Fund of the Bank of so much of the amount standing to the credit of the Multi-Purpose Special Fund of the Bank at a date specified in the agreement as consists of—
(i) moneys contributed in accordance with this Act;
(ii) moneys received by the Bank in repayment of loans made out of moneys so contributed; and
(iii) interest received by the Bank on moneys referred to in sub-paragraphs (i) and (ii); and
(b) the use, for the purposes of the Asian Development Fund, of the amount so transferred.
“(2) An agreement in accordance with this section may contain such terms and conditions as the Minister determines, and may vary or rescind an agreement made under section 4.”.
